Ordinals
beta
Address bc1q0j6kp8d3lm3096944vuc84v5x7fe92ykkrm6x4
sat balance
3913
runes balances
outputs
822aa050df718556e01d44baa3f6b0e197e4ae55740bb30340e007aac2e97a3a:1